Output 57cba4701c526152d9a4ed2a7e0c709186f507ad4fba01d879623c1d5d3d195e:29

value
77579699
script pubkey
OP_0 OP_PUSHBYTES_32 02c606ebfc20b833ff5487cfd14e086ea9d2719ec41b314a9bba5c26a74db7bb
address
bc1qqtrqd6luyzur8l65sl8aznsgd65ayuv7csdnzj5mhfwzdf6dk7ashkjsq9
transaction
57cba4701c526152d9a4ed2a7e0c709186f507ad4fba01d879623c1d5d3d195e
spent
true